Answer: Azure Firewall
The question asks for a service that filters network traffic across multiple Azure subscriptions and virtual networks. Azure Firewall is the correct answer because it is a centralized, managed firewall service designed specifically for this purpose. In contrast, Network Security Groups (NSGs) are distributed and operate within a single subscription and VNet, not across them. Application Security Groups (ASGs) are for grouping VMs within NSGs, and Azure DDoS Protection defends against volumetric attacks but does not filter traffic based on subscriptions or VNets.
